Cybersecurity Compliance Advisor
il y a 2 semaines
YOUR ROLE Would you like to join our global team in different cybersecurity missions and challenges with the focus on Governance, Risk and Compliance? If so, we have the opportunity to join our team as Cybersecurity Compliance Advisor for our compliance activities. In this role you will be in charge of the ISO27001 certification of CMA CGM's logistics activities. This role is open in France, Puteaux or Marseille. WHAT ARE YOU GOING TO DO? You ensure that the key CEVA Logistics activities comply with ISO27001 standard.You lead the annual ISO27001 surveillance or certification project.You maintain the ISMS scope.You oversee the delivery of actions identified from previous ISO27001 audits.You maintain relationships with (senior) stakeholders involved in ISMS above cybersecurity. WHAT ARE WE LOOKING FOR? You have Minimum 5 years of experience in IT-related fields.You have experience in information security or audits.You have significant experience in implementing ISO27001.You have deep knowledge of at least two of the following regulations: NIS, DFARS, SWIFT, CMMC, TiSAX, NIST CS.You have the certification of ISO 27001 ISMS Lead Auditor or Lead Implementer. Having following certifications is a plus: Certified Information Systems Security Professional (CISSP).Certified Information System Auditor or Manager (CISA-CISM).IT Infrastructure Library (ITIL). Skills You have a good understanding of cybersecurity management processes and methodologies (e.g., ISMS ISO 27001, SMCA ISO 22301, NIST framework).You have a good understanding of IT operations, processes, and methodologies, audit and internal control methodologies (COSO, Cobit), and organizational resilience processes (BCP/DRP).You have the skill to simplify and convey complex messages to an executive audience, including finance, risks, business impacts, and performance indicators.You have the ability to adapt to various situations and adjust behavior based on the environment and type of interlocutor.You have excellent written communication, analytical, and synthesis skills, especially orally.You have proficiency in English.
